3. Test the Stability of Fence Posts
Fence posts are the backbone of your fence, providing its strength and stability. Winter's freeze-thaw cycle wreaks havoc on posts, especially if they're not set deep enough. Check each post by lightly pushing on it—if it wobbles or feels loose, it might need reinforcement.
4. Inspect Hardware and Fasteners
Screws, nails, brackets, and hinges tend to wear down over time, and cold weather can accelerate this process. Check for rust, loosened screws, or broken fasteners and replace any damaged hardware.
5. Look at the Gates
Gates often see the most wear and tear throughout the year, so give them extra attention. Ensure they align properly, latch securely, and swing without obstruction. A sagging or misaligned gate might indicate underlying fence issues.
6. Clear Away Snow and Debris
Heavy snow and debris can weigh down on your fence and contribute to damage. Use a broom to gently clear snow off your fence. Avoid shoveling directly against it to prevent damaging the base or causing warping.
